Sloppy Joe Grilled Cheese Sandwiches

Easy to make Sloppy Joe Grilled Cheese Sandwiches are the perfect comfort foods. 
Print Rate
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 10 minutes
Total Time: 20 minutes
Servings: 4
Calories: 229kcal
Author: Tammilee Tips

Ingredients

  • 8 slices Bread
  • 2 Cup Sloppy Joe’s
  • 4 slices American cheese
  • Butter

Instructions

  •  Sloppy Joe mix is homemade and EASY – 1 pound of ground beef browned and drained, ¼ C. of organic ketchup (more or less to taste). 2 tsp. of mustard and 1 tsp. of brown sugar.
  • Preheat a medium-size frying pan (or griddle) or medium heat. Generously butter the outsides of your bread slices. Lay 2 slices of the bread butter side down and top with 1 slice of cheese.
  • Add about ¼ of a cup of Sloppy Joe mix and top with another slice of cheese. Top with the second slice of bread, butter side up and let brown on the bottom.
  • Carefully flip when browned and allow the other bread slices to brown evenly on the other side.
  •  Remove from the pan and let set a minute or 2 and cut each sandwich in half. Serve by itself or with chips or soup to make a meal.
Frying Pan

Notes

*Makes 1 servings of two sandwiches.
